How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Grant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Grant Park Studio Apartments | $2,279 | $1,429 | $3,219 |
| Grant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,750 | $1,739 | $6,693 |
| Grant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,798 | $1,790 | $10,000+ |
| Grant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,598 | $989 | $10,000+ |
| Grant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,652 | $924 | $8,740 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Grant Park
How much are Studio apartments in Grant Park?
There are currently 87 Studio Apartments in Grant Park with rent ranges from $1,429 to $3,219 with an average price of $2,279.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Grant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Grant Park ranges from $1,739 to $6,693 with an average monthly rent of $2,750.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Grant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Grant Park range from $1,790 to $10,240.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,798.
How expensive are Grant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 52 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Grant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$989 to $12,450 - averaging $4,598 for the location.
